Transaction 6ea1fec340ccfbf4930bf18b8a5767c6d72db1d1c8f5f9b86b1a9d48e8b107e7
3 Input
1 Outputs
- 6ea1fec340ccfbf4930bf18b8a5767c6d72db1d1c8f5f9b86b1a9d48e8b107e7:0
value 2768115
address 1HLvdz1BsnfjsNKc7U5BEDgupCM7Uh2wmQ